Vijayawada, April 29 -- Andhra Pradesh Minister for Municipal Administration P Narayana has said that arrangements for Prime Minister Narendra Modi's programme, to be held on May 2, are almost complete.
The Prime Minister will re-launch the development works of AP capital city and address a public meeting in the capital region Amaravati on May 2. Municipal Administration Minister P Narayana, accompanied by officials, inspected the arrangements for the Prime Minister's programme at the capital region on Tuesday.
Narayana inspected the dais, VVIP enclosure, parking slots and the routes leading to the venue. The Minister said that 90 per cent of arrangements for the Prime Minister's programme have been completed.
